Kothattai Village

Kothattai is an inhabited village in Chidambaram Taluk of Cuddalore district, Tamil Nadu. Its Census village code is 636757, the Census 2011 record lists 3,928 people in 939 households and the reported area is 770.62 hectares. The local references include Kothattai Gram Panchayat, Parangipettai CD Block and the nearest town reference is Parangipettai.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 3,928 people in 939 households, with 2,009 male residents and 1,919 female residents. The average household size is 4.18, and SC share is 10.39% and ST share is 0.15% for Kothattai. Population density works out to about 509.72 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Kothattai show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, Ground Nut and Black Gram, net sown area is 369.4 hectares and irrigated land is 23.16 hectares (6.3%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
